Q: Is 135,752,235 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 135,752,235 is a composite number.

Why is 135,752,235 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 135,752,235 can be evenly divided by 1 3 5 15 173 519 865 2,595 52,313 156,939 261,565 784,695 9,050,149 27,150,447 45,250,745 and 135,752,235, with no remainder.

Since 135,752,235 cannot be divided by just 1 and 135,752,235, it is a composite number.
